"The Blues Are Still Blue" is probably the sweetest love song which uses a trip to the launderette as an allegory. Or at least in the top ten anyway.

All of the typical Belle & Sebastian ingredients are here, catchy melodies, sweet harmonies and jangly guitars, but they are augmented by a glam style boogie, like they're channelling the spirit of Marc Bolan, making this an upbeat, soulful affair, which takes on The Magic Numbers on at their own game and wins hands-down.

They get extra brownie points for good, fun b-sides, one of which is the best cover version of "Whiskey In The Jar"
you will ever hear, which miraculously doesn't roam into pub-rock territory. Bobby Steele and the Valentinos from the Fox and Hound, eat your hearts out.
